Problems solved by technology

[0005] A lot of industrial wastewater has complex components, many pollutants are separated separately, and the electrochemical reaction in a single form is often unsatisfactory. For example, in the surface treatment industry, many wastewater containing heavy metals may also contain high concentrations of surfactants, Organic substances such as reducing agents have a high COD value. Electrocoagulation, which has excellent efficiency in removing heavy metals, is powerless against organic substances in this type of wastewater. The concentration of organic substances in wastewater discharged from the pesticide and chemical industries is high, and electro-oxidation is often used. It is used in the degradation of this type of wastewater, but many wastewaters contain chlorine-based organics or organics with high oxidation potential, and the electro-oxidation also performs poorly. At this time, the assistance of electro-reduction is needed to replace organics or reduce the oxidation potential.
[0006] At present, for this kind of mixed wastewater, cumbersome and segmented reaction equipment is always used to meet the process requirements, which not only increases the manufacturing cost and treatment cost, but also increases the difficulty of operation and management, so a method that can be based on Different wastewater requirements, and then electrochemical treatment devices that combine electrochemical reactions with different reaction mechanisms become the key to technological breakthroughs

Abstract

A treatment device for mixed electrochemical wastewater is disclosed. The device has three combination manners, namely an electric flocculation assembly having an electrooxidation function, an electrooxidation assembly having an electric flocculation function and an electrooxidation assembly having electroreduction and electric flocculation functions. The device has an innovative manufacturing manner and polar plate combination modes of the electrochemical wastewater treatment device, different manners of application of different polar plates in the device allow the range of pollutants that can be treated to be expanded, integrated application of the device in wastewater treatment is improved, and the device is of great significance for development of electrochemical techniques in wastewater treatment.

Technical field [0001] The invention relates to the field of electrochemical wastewater treatment, in particular to a mixed electrochemical wastewater treatment device. Background technique [0002] The electrochemical wastewater treatment device is based on the electrochemical reaction theory, a wastewater treatment technology that uses different metal plates to electrochemically react under a certain direct current to remove pollutants in the wastewater. [0003] From the principle of reaction, electrochemistry is generally divided into three types: electro-flocculation, electro-oxidation and electro-reduction. Electro-flocculation generally uses sacrificial plates such as aluminum and iron as the reaction plates, which can generate a large number of flocculent new ions during the reaction process to electrolytically flocculate substances in the wastewater; electro-oxidation generally uses titanium-based coatings as the reactive electrodes.
